In January-August 2021, Russian furniture imports increased by 34.4%

October 13, 2021 ` 12:37  
In January-August 2021, the value of Russian furniture imports increased by 34.4% YoY to $1.565 billion, as reported by the Federal Customs Service of Russia. In August 2021, imports amounted to $209.9 million (+ 1.1% MoM).
